Worley is a leading global provider of professional project and asset services in the energy, chemicals and resources sectors. We have around 57,000 amazing people in 60 countries across the world covering the full lifecycle, from creating new assets to sustaining and enhancing operating assets for our customers.

The Worley Undergraduate Program offers exposure to real-world projects across the Energy, Chemicals and Resources sectors. Working alongside industry leaders, you will develop specialist skills in your field of study while gaining exposure to technically challenging and high-profile projects in the market. Your role may include assisting with feasibility studies which may grow and develop into complex EPCM projects which will require you to draw on your theoretical experience to help execute delivery and develop ideas.
Successful applicants will be expected to be available for a 3-month contract (December 2020 to February 2021), with the potential of continued work during your final year of study and consideration for a full-time role in our graduate Program in 2022. The roles may be based in any of our city or regional offices and willingness to travel to sites is essential.
